10 years ago an EK recruitment manager told me it cost a minimum of 2 million AED from recruitment to LHS...all the recruitment costs, costs of bringing in supporting the family, and training from RHS to LHS. Nowadays it would be 50% more than that at least.

Factor in say 3.5 million AED into the monthly pay difference between a new Captain and a 15 year Captain, and it's clearly better to retain an experienced Captain until retirement than it is to wave him goodbye to save at most 15,000AED a month. On that simple equation, it would take 19 years to recover the replacement costs of the experienced Captain with a new guy in the LHS (ex DE FO) and maybe 40% of that time for a DEC

A line captain leaves. The company is up for the expensive of selecting and upgrading an FO to Capt, and also the expense of recruiting and training a new FO. The more qualifications you have, the more expensive to replace. A TRE leaves. The company is up for the expense of selecting and training a TRI to TRE. Selecting and training a line Capt to TRI. Selecting and upgrading an FO to Capt. Recruiting and training a new FO.
The "if you don't like it leave" attitude is expensive.
